Pogo has released Zuma Slots.
It can be added to your favorites.    The betting — and winning — in this game revolves around Coins, not Pogo tokens. When you start the game, you will get 15,000 Coins (non-Club Pogo players get less), and every 4 hours you can refill your bucket with more Coins by loading the game and refilling your bucket.

    You can stake anywhere from 200 to 3,000 Coins per spin, but the number of lines you play is always the same.

    Club Pogo members can play the game in full-screen by clicking the icon in the upper right corner of the game.

    If you run out of Coins and want to purchase more, you can do so by clicking your Coins bucket. There are three Coin Packages to choose from: 10,000 coins for 6 Gems, 44,000 coins for 18 Gems, and 150,000 coins for 56 Gems (these are Club Pogo prices, non-Club players pay 8, 22, and 67 respectively).
    There's a bonus game that has the potential to earn lots of Coins — start it by spinning up three frogs on the reels.
    You can auto-play the reels for 10, 20, 30, 40, or 50 spins. You can't just walk away because if you enter the bonus round, the game will need your input. As the game is auto-spinning, you can stop it by clicking the "Stop Auto-Play" button above the number of auto-spins left.
    Tip: to speed up the calculations at the end of a winning spin during auto-play, just click the Spin button again.
